What are Yahoo! Badges?

Tags:

Yahoo! Answers uses badges to designate the different types of community members participating in the Yahoo! Answers community. Here is an explanation of the different types and their meaning:

  • – An Official badge indicates that the identity of a community member asking or answering questions on Yahoo! Answers has been verified by a member of the Yahoo! Answers Team. This helps us distinguish our celebrity, professional, and sponsor participants within the Yahoo! Answers community.
  • – The Staff badge displays when members of the Yahoo! Answers Team or other Yahoo! staff members officially ask and answer questions on Yahoo! Answers.
  • – The Top Contributor badge is used to recognize a member of the Answers community who has shown that they are knowledgeable in a particular category. The top contributor badge is dynamic, which means that you earn it or lose it depending on your recent participation in a particular category. It’s because Animax Asia has produced the first ever original animation production (in high definition!) called “LaMB“. “LaMB”, based on an award-winning script by Filipino amateur writer Carmelo Juinio, is situated in the future on a harsh desert planet called Cerra. And on Cerra, they practice the idea of “recycling” so strongly that even hard-core criminals are “recycled” as slaves. These prisoners go through a process of “Lamination” where they become human ‘robots’. They can’t talk, they can’t make decisions on their own and they can only obey the commands by their masters or get electrocuted as punishment. And the worse thing? When the prisoners are ‘laminated’, they are preserved in a way for hundreds of years until released from their bodily prison.
